Advanced Machining Processes
2
Introduction to Non-Conventional Machining
One of the significant sections in the book is dedicated to non-conventional machining
methods such as:
Electrical Discharge Machining (EDM)
Electron Beam Machining (EBM)
Laser Beam Machining (LBM)
Ultrasonic Machining (USM)
Chemical Machining (CM)
These processes are crucial for machining hard materials and complex shapes that
traditional methods cannot achieve efficiently. The book explains the working principles,
advantages, limitations, and applications of each process, supported by diagrams for
better understanding.
Advantages and Applications
- Ability to machine difficult-to-cut materials like tungsten and ceramics - High precision
and complex shape manufacturing - Use in aerospace, medical, and tooling industries ---

Content Breakdown and Structure
The book is systematically organized into multiple chapters, each focusing on specific
aspects of workshop technology. Here's an overview of the main sections:
1. Lathe Machines and Operations
- Types of lathes - Construction and working principles - Various operations such as facing,
turning, tapering, knurling, and threading - Special attachments and accessories
2. Drilling Machines and Operations
- Types of drilling machines - Drilling, reaming, tapping, and boring processes - Types of
drills and their applications
3. Milling Machines and Operations
- Types of milling machines (plain, universal, vertical) - Milling operations such as face
milling, end milling, slotting - Gear cutting and other specialized milling processes
4. Shaping and Slotting Machines
- Working principles - Operations like keyway cutting, contour shaping
5. Grinding Machines
- Types of grinding machines - Surface, cylindrical, and internal grinding - Abrasive wheels
and safety precautions
6. Welding and Metal Joining Processes
- Types of welding (Arc, Gas, Resistance) - Equipment and safety considerations -
Applications in fabrication
7. Surface Finishing and Finishing Processes
- Polishing, buffing, and grinding - Surface treatment techniques
Workshop Technology 2 By Hajra Choudhary
7
8. Modern Manufacturing Techniques
- CNC machines - Automation and computer-aided manufacturing This detailed content
structure ensures that learners progressively build their understanding from basic to
advanced workshop practices, with each chapter complemented by diagrams,
illustrations, and practical examples. ---
